SEX AND POLITICS: HOW INTIMACY CAN BUILD TRUST WITH CONSTITUENTS OR DESTROY REPUTATION WHEN LEAKED?

Politics is a complex domain that relies heavily on public perceptions of politicians and their behaviors to influence the electorate's opinions. When a leader keeps his/her private life out of the spotlight, it can make them appear more trustworthy and relatable.

When these actions are revealed later, they may tarnish the reputation of the politician.

Bill Clinton was criticized for having an affair while married to Hillary Clinton, which caused him to lose some support from voters.

Politicians who engage in corruption or scandalous activities may be seen as untrustworthy by constituents and lose credibility.

Intimate secrets can also play a role in creating loyalty among supporters. When a politician shares personal details with followers or is perceived to have a close relationship with them, it can build trust between the leader and those he/she leads. This is often used strategically by politicians to gain popularity and win elections. Some leaders even share intimate details about themselves to create a sense of familiarity with voters.

Barack Obama shared details of his family life during his campaign, allowing voters to relate to him personally.

Betrayal is often associated with breach of trust, which can lead to political downfall. When a politician breaks promises made to constituents, such as by supporting certain policies or making decisions without consulting them, it can cause distrust and anger.

When George W. Bush launched the invasion of Iraq without publicly revealing evidence that would justify the action, many Americans lost faith in his leadership abilities. Similarly, when a leader's private behaviors conflict with their public image, such as Donald Trump's alleged extramarital affairs, it can erode trust in the person leading the country.

Leaders' intimate secrets shape narratives of trust, loyalty, and betrayal in politics through creating connections, building trust, and betraying promises. These actions influence how people view a politician's character and ability to govern effectively. Therefore, understanding how these factors interact with each other is essential for successful political leadership.
